Medicinal Chemistry Minor

The Medicinal Chemistry Minor requires 3.0 credits as follows:
CH250, CH301, CH350, CH456;
At least 1.0 credit from: CH404, CH419, CH433, CH358, CH453, CH458, CH480 or CH495. See Note 4.

Notes:

  1. Exclusion: All BSc Honours Chemistry programs, All BSc Honours Biochemistry and Biotechnology programs, and Chemistry Minor. 
  2. Refer to university-wide Requirements_for Minors/Options.
  3. Students who would like to pursue this minor must consult with the undergraduate advisor for the Chemistry and Biochemistry Department after Year 2 to develop a course schedule for minor completion.
  4. Students who would like to take CH480 or CH495 to fulfill their minor requirements must consult with the undergraduate advisor for the Chemistry and Biochemistry Department for confirmation that the course content aligns with minor expectations.
